Aberdeen FC Community Trust is an award-winning charity, existing to provide support and opportunity to change lives for the better, across the North East Scotland and beyond.
AFCCT is the independent partner charity of Aberdeen Football Club and, together with the ‘hook’ of football, utilises the Club’s high profile, brand and connections to enhance the delivery of the trust’s charitable objectives to benefit local communities and positively influence others.
